Show Notes

There are some jobs that would be impossible to leave at the door when you get home. After 34 years in the police and 25 years in homicide, retired Detective Inspector Gary Jubelin knows that all too well. Having spent his incredible career catching killers – including the high profile disappearance of William Tyrell – the emotional toll and impact on his family has been huge. Gary is now the host of the I Catch Killers podcast which is back for a whole new season, and he joins us now to open about the heartbreak of not getting the chance to catch William's killer and how he processes all the horrific things he's seen.
